    Job Description: Civil Engineering Principal/Manager

    KiloNewton is a dynamic technical consulting and software company, focusing on engineering and analysis in the solar and renewables industry. We are a small firm with a unique focus on the optimization of utility-scale plants, working with dozens of global-scale development and construction companies. If you are a self-motivated professional who is looking for a company that will allow you to quickly grow your career, while making the world a cleaner, better place, then KiloNewton is for you

    KiloNewton is searching for an ambitious individual who is an experienced civil engineering leader that enjoys working both in and out of their comfort zone. The ideal candidate will leverage their professional skills in analysis, design and leadership, heading a team in preparing calculations, drawings, and project deliverables in civil design, survey, structural analysis, and other related work.

    The candidate will be skilled in using computer analysis and drafting software, including AutoCAD, Civil 3D, and AutoDesk analysis packages, ArcGIS software, HEC-RAS and/or other G&D/hydrology software. The ideal candidate will also have experience with steel driven foundation design, interpreting geotechnical reports, and must hold a current valid PE license for stamping submittals, or be able to obtain it within 3 months. Designs/models must be created and analyzed with accurate detail that incorporates permitting ordinances, design inputs, sketches, field/customer notes, and must be able to comprehend, interpret, and render verbal inputs from customers and other stakeholders as required.

    Civil Engineering Principal/Manager Job Description and Responsibilities

    • Assess project and its requirements
    • Assess the impact and feasibility of site due diligence, preliminary layout and up to the final engineering design
    • Leading other technical staff to create, test, validate, and use innovative new automated processes for engineering design and analysis
    • Create new business through client outreach, developing new service offerings, and enhancing current services
    • Prepare drawings and schematic designs based on project requirements
    • Study and assess drawings, plans, specifications and other documents relating to construction projects
    • Create, review, and approve civil and structural plans, calculations, and permitting documents for submittals to customers, AHJs, and site owners
    • Experience with creation and review of typical civil submittals, such as SWPPP, and other state/federal permitting requirements
    • Determine budget, project schedules and scope of work and deploy appropriate staff
    • Preparing bids for prospective clients
    • Supervisingproject teams, including the direction, lead and support other engineering and skilled personnel in managing and executing multiple tasks and projects
    • Lead and direct onsite and offsite teams as necessary
    • Collaborate, manage, and interact with construction teams, surveyors, architects, and outside project developers, EPCs, AHJs, and consultants
    • Manage deliverables on time and within the budget
    • Initiate and ensure standard civil engineering discipline in drawings and plans including surveying, grading, geotechnical, wind, seismic, snow and hydrology analyses
    • Working closely on construction plans with clients, architects, andother professionals
    • Developing design ideas usingCAD, FEA, and GIS software
    • Using computer simulations to predict how various site designs, and structures will react under different conditions
    • Making sure that projects meet legal guidelines, environmental directives, and health and safety requirements according to code
    • Giving progress reports to clients and senior managers
    • Adhere to the best practices, standards and procedures of the company

    Civil Engineering Principal/Manager Skills and Requirements

    • Expertise in field of study to independently design and analyze civil and/or structural projects
    • Knowledge of principles, practices, and methods related to FEA/CAD
    • Working knowledge of GIS techniques such as map production, editing, and geocoding
    • Highly proficient in MS Word, Excel, MS Project
    • Proficiency in other civil/structural programs such as Flo3D, LPILE, and other related programs
    • Knowledge of solar design software and processes a plus
    • Demonstrated customer relationship and people skills
    • Demonstrated excellent communications skills (written, verbal and presentation)
    • Demonstrated excellent organizational skills and be detail oriented
    • Master's Degree in Civil Engineering or equivalent required
    • Professional Engineering License in relevant discipline
    • 3+ years experience in solar/renewable energy engineering highly preferred
    • 3+ years experience leading a civil engineering team required
    • 10 years of experience in civil/structural engineering, in a variety of tasks relevant to solar design, however more specialized candidates will be considered
